Mauricio Pochettino has taken aim at England after revealing that Ben Chilwell was a doubt for this weekend’s game.

Chilwell was involved in the majority of the Three Lions’ two friendlies against Brazil and Belgium, playing the full 90 in the second game.

During his press conference ahead of his side’s game against Burnley, Pochettino admitted that the left back was a doubt for the fixture and in an ideal world, would’ve preferred to see him eased back into action.

“Surprised, not surprised, I don’t know. If he cannot play with us or be available, because he didn’t play after Brentford with us. He played a few minutes against Leicester. He started two games,” the Blues boss said.

“It’s a surprise for us. But it’s bad luck because he got a dead leg in the last moment of the game against Belgium.”

Palmer set to be fit for weekend fixture

Cole Palmer and Conor Gallagher were also away with England. While Gallagher featured Palmer wasn’t involved in either of the games after picking up an injury that saw him train on his own individual programme.

There were fears that he may not be ready to return to action but reports suggested that he tried upon his return to Chelsea on Wednesday and Pochettino was confident he would be available.

Pochettino said: “Yes, he is a little bit disappointed because he couldn’t play or perform with the national team. He had a small problem for the first game and thought he could play the second game. He is OK and training well.

“I think the plan is if he trains in the same way, he will be available for the game on Saturday.”
